Go Through CAT Tests With Them

CAT (Cognitive Ability Test) is a test that measures a child’s cognitive abilities and academic potential. Many schools use CAT scores to place children in classes and make decisions about their educational future.

It is important for parents to understand what the CAT test is and how it works. You can explain this to your children by telling them that the CAT test is a way for the school to see how smart they are and how well they might do in school.

You can also tell them that it is important to try their best on the test so that the school can see how much they have learned. If your children are resistant to taking tests, you can try to make it more fun for them by going through the CAT test with them.

You can help them to understand the concepts that they will be tested on and give them tips on how to do their best. There are also many resources available that can help make learning fun for kids, like CAT4 Level C practice papers found online, which can help them to prepare for the test in a fun and engaging way. You can also find CAT resources for parents online, which can help you to understand the test and how to best prepare your child for it.

Expose Them To Activities That Relay The Importance Of Education

One way you can explain the importance of education to your kids is by exposing them to activities that relay this message. For example, you can take them to visit a college campus or have them shadow someone in a job that requires a higher level of education. Seeing first-hand how education can benefit them in their future may help your children understand why it is so important.

Another way to stress the importance of education is by speaking positively about your own experiences in school. Sharing stories about how education has helped you in your career or personal life can show your kids that there are many benefits to getting good grades and doing well in school.

You can also reinforce the importance of education by setting high standards for your children in school. Help them to understand that you expect them to do their best and strive for excellence in their studies. Showing them that you believe in their ability to succeed will encourage them to put forth their best effort.

Develop A Learning Atmosphere

One way to make sure your kids understand the importance of education is to develop a learning atmosphere at home. You can do this by making sure there are plenty of books and educational toys around the house. You can also set aside a specific time each day for homework and reading. By doing this, you’ll be sending the message that learning is a priority in your family.

It’s also important to be a good role model when it comes to education. Let your kids see you reading, working on projects, and continuing to learn new things. This will show them that learning is something that doesn’t stop after school ends.

Finally, make sure to praise your kids when they do well in school or accomplish something they’re proud of. This will show them that their hard work is paying off and that you think their education is important.

Developing a learning atmosphere at home is a great way to show your kids how important education is. By making books and learning a priority, you’ll be setting them up for success in school and in life.
